{eval=Array;=+count(Array);}
這是一個(gè)非常好的問題,作為一名IT行業(yè)的從業(yè)者,同時(shí)也是一名教育工作者,我來回答一下這個(gè)問題。
Python語言目前是IT行業(yè)內(nèi)最為流行的編程語言之一,同時(shí)Python也是全場(chǎng)景編程語言之一,目前在Web開發(fā)、大數(shù)據(jù)開發(fā)、人工智能開發(fā)和嵌入式開發(fā)領(lǐng)域均有應(yīng)用,所以Python是當(dāng)今程序員的重要開發(fā)工具。
Python語言之所以能夠得到廣泛的應(yīng)用,一定離不開Python語言的諸多優(yōu)點(diǎn),這其中就包括語法簡(jiǎn)單、擴(kuò)展方便、資源整合能力強(qiáng)等等,但是這些優(yōu)點(diǎn)其他語言也有,之所以Python目前有明顯的上升趨勢(shì),一個(gè)重要的原因是Python語言非常契合大數(shù)據(jù)和人工智能的開發(fā)場(chǎng)景,或者說“實(shí)驗(yàn)場(chǎng)景”,這使得Python語言得到了廣泛的應(yīng)用。
Python語言并不是一個(gè)新出現(xiàn)的編程語言,Python語言與Java語言是同一時(shí)期的編程語言,而Python語言早期并沒有像Java語言那樣得到廣泛的應(yīng)用,直到大數(shù)據(jù)、云計(jì)算和人工智能相關(guān)技術(shù)得到廣泛關(guān)注的時(shí)候,Python語言才作為一個(gè)重要的工具得到了大量的應(yīng)用。
實(shí)際上,Python語言之所以能夠在大數(shù)據(jù)、人工智能等領(lǐng)域得到廣泛應(yīng)用,原因有三點(diǎn),其一是Python語言比較簡(jiǎn)單,研發(fā)人員可以把主要精力放在算法實(shí)現(xiàn)上;其二是Python語言有豐富的庫(kù)可以使用,這能夠明顯提升開發(fā)效率;其三是Python語言整合資源的能力比較強(qiáng),大量的已有資源可以通過Python來調(diào)用,這也節(jié)省了大量的時(shí)間。可以說,Python語言是研發(fā)人員早期在做技術(shù)驗(yàn)證時(shí)比較常見的選擇,因?yàn)镻ython語言能節(jié)省大量的開發(fā)時(shí)間,這可以說是Python語言最為重要的優(yōu)點(diǎn)之一。
我從事互聯(lián)網(wǎng)行業(yè)多年,目前也在帶計(jì)算機(jī)專業(yè)的研究生,主要的研究方向集中在大數(shù)據(jù)和人工智能領(lǐng)域,我會(huì)陸續(xù)寫一些關(guān)于互聯(lián)網(wǎng)技術(shù)方面的文章,感興趣的朋友可以關(guān)注我,相信一定會(huì)有所收獲。
如果有互聯(lián)網(wǎng)、大數(shù)據(jù)、人工智能等方面的問題,或者是考研方面的問題,都可以在評(píng)論區(qū)留言,或者私信我!
謝邀
首先我想說Python是世界上最好的語言(不服請(qǐng)留言來辯)
首先Python能做什么?
web開發(fā)
網(wǎng)絡(luò),游戲編程
多媒體
算法工程化
Python的就業(yè)方向
后端開發(fā)
數(shù)據(jù)分析
運(yùn)維工程師
爬蟲工程師
金融量化
大數(shù)據(jù)
算法工程化
語言優(yōu)點(diǎn)很明顯
1.容易學(xué)習(xí),可讀性強(qiáng),使用簡(jiǎn)單。
有一個(gè)干凈而像英語的語法,它需要較少的代碼,并讓程序員專注于業(yè)務(wù)邏輯,而不是考慮語言的本質(zhì)。
2.代碼開發(fā)效率很高
3.主流框架:
Google開源機(jī)器學(xué)習(xí)框架:TensorFlow
開源社區(qū)主推學(xué)習(xí)框架:Scikit-learn
百度開源深度學(xué)習(xí)框架:Paddle
這些都是用python開發(fā)的
最后我想說,代碼之路無止盡保持一顆不斷學(xué)習(xí)的心繼續(xù)前行吧
Python是世界上最好的語言沒有之一[靈光一閃]
2
回答0
回答0
回答0
回答10
回答0
回答1
回答10
回答7
回答0
回答